SQL Server 2005 リソースに依存関係を追加する方法

複数のディスク ドライブで構成される Windows 2000 クラスタ グループに Microsoft SQL Server 2005 をインストールし、いずれかのドライブにデータを保存するように選択すると、SQL Server リソースはそのドライブにのみ依存するように設定されます。別のディスクにデータやログを保存するには、まず、そのディスクに対する依存関係を SQL Server リソースに追加する必要があります。

SQL Server グループに他のリソースを追加する場合、そのリソースには必ず独自の固有の SQL ネットワーク名リソースと独自の SQL IP アドレス リソースが必要なので注意してください。

SQL Server 以外の既存の SQL ネットワーク名リソースおよび SQL IP アドレス リソースを使用しないでください。SQL Server リソースが他のリソースと共有されると、次の問題が発生する場合があります。

  • 予期しない障害が発生する。
  • サービス パックを正常にインストールできない。
  • SQL Server セットアップ プログラムが正常に実行されない。この問題が発生した場合は、SQL Server の追加インスタンスをインストールしたり、定期的なメンテナンスを実行したりできません。

さらに次の問題も考慮してください。

  • SQL Server レプリケーションでの FTP : SQL Server レプリケーションで FTP を使用する SQL Server のインスタンスでは、FTP サービスを使用するようにセットアップされた SQL Server のインストールと同じ物理ディスクのいずれかを FTP サービスで使用する必要があります。
  • SQL Server リソースの依存関係 : SQL Server グループにリソースを追加し、SQL Server を使用できるようにするために SQL Server リソースに依存している場合は、SQL Server エージェント リソースに依存関係を追加することをお勧めします。SQL Server リソースに依存関係を追加しないでください。SQL Server を実行しているコンピュータで高い可用性を維持するには、SQL Server エージェント リソースに障害が発生した場合に SQL Server グループが影響を受けないように SQL Server エージェント リソースを構成します。
  • ファイル共有とプリンタ リソース : ファイル共有リソースやプリンタ クラスタ リソースをインストールするときは、SQL Server を実行しているコンピュータと同じ物理ディスク リソースに配置しないでください。同じ物理ディスク リソースにインストールすると、SQL Server を実行しているコンピュータのパフォーマンスが低下したり、サービスが失われたりする場合があります。
  • MS DTC の考慮事項 : オペレーティング システムをインストールしクラスタを構成してから、クラスタ アドミニストレータを使用して、クラスタ内で機能するように MS DTC を構成する必要があります。MS DTC のクラスタ化に失敗しても SQL Server 2005 セットアップが中止されることはありませんが、MS DTC が適切に構成されていないと SQL Server 2005 アプリケーションの機能が影響を受ける場合があります。
    SQL Server グループに Microsoft 分散トランザクション コーディネータ (MS DTC) をインストールし、MS DTC に依存する他のリソースがある場合は、このグループがオフラインまたはフェールオーバー中であると、MS DTC を使用できません。既定では、SQL Server の新しいインストールで SQL Server フェールオーバー ウィザードを実行するときに、MS DTC リソースを SQL Server グループに配置する必要があります。MS DTC が既にクラスタ化されている場合、SQL Server 7.0 では既存の場所とリソースを使用しますが、SQL Server 2000 では使用しません。可能であれば、独自の物理ディスク リソースがある独自のグループに MS DTC を配置することをお勧めします。

SQL Server 2005 リソースに依存関係を追加するには

  1. Windows の管理ツールで [クラスタ アドミニストレータ] を開きます。

  2. 依存させる適切な SQL Server リソースが含まれているグループを検索します。

  3. ディスクのリソースがこのグループに既にある場合は、手順 4. に進みます。それ以外の場合は、ディスクが含まれているグループを探します。そのグループと、SQL Server が含まれているグループが同じノードに所有されていない場合は、ディスクのリソースが含まれているグループを、SQL Server グループを所有するノードに移動します。

  4. SQL Server リソースをオフラインにします。

  5. SQL Server リソースを選択し、[プロパティ] ダイアログ ボックスを開きます。[依存関係] タブを使用して、SQL Server 依存関係のセットにディスクを追加します。

参照

概念

フェールオーバー クラスタリングをインストールする前に

その他の技術情報

SQL Server 2005 セットアップ ログ ファイルを表示する方法
SQL Server 2005 のセットアップ ログ ファイルを読み取る方法

ヘルプおよび情報

SQL Server 2005 の参考資料の入手